Q1: Can I use regular milk instead of coconut milk?

Absolutely! While coconut milk adds a tropical flair, you can substitute it with regular milk if you prefer a milder taste. The bread will still be deliciously buttery.

Q2: Can I freeze Caribbean Butter Bread?

Certainly! Once cooled, wrap the bread in plastic wrap and place it in a freezer bag. It can be frozen for up to three months. Thaw at room temperature when you’re ready to enjoy a taste of the tropics.
